The 3 Core Silhouettes Explained
1. The Straight-Cut Kurta
Clean vertical seams with sharp side slits. It draws the eye vertically upward, creating the illusion of extra height. Ideal for corporate environments and casual denim pairings.
2. The A-Line Kurta
Narrow at the chest and progressively flaring outward from below the bust. It never hugs the waist or hips tightly, making it the universally forgiving everyday silhouette.
3. The Full-Flare Anarkali
Structured fitted bodice that blossoms into 12 to 24 pleated kalis (fabric panels). Unmatched for formal events, weddings, and celebrations.
